news 2026/4/16 0:18:35

破局测试数据困境:双轨战略的实战路径

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
破局测试数据困境:双轨战略的实战路径

在敏捷开发与合规监管的双重压力下,测试数据管理已成为软件测试的卡脖子环节。本文针对测试从业者面临的"数据荒原"与"隐私雷区",提出可落地的数据供应链重构方案。

一、数据困局的三维痛点

  1. 供给时延黑洞

    • 典型场景:30%测试周期消耗在等待生产数据克隆

    • 案例:某金融项目因等待敏感数据脱敏审批,SIT阶段延期两周

  2. 隐私合规风暴

    • GDPR与《个人信息保护法》实施后,83%企业遭遇测试数据违规投诉

    • 致命错误:未脱敏的客户身份证号出现在测试日志

  3. 数据失真危机

    • 58%的缺陷漏测源于陈旧数据与生产环境偏差

二、按需制造:构建测试数据工厂

graph TD
A[需求触发] --> B(智能数据建模)
B --> C{数据类型}
C -->|敏感数据| D[脱敏引擎]
C -->|非敏感数据| E[生产数据采样]
D --> F[动态子集生成]
E --> F
F --> G[容器化数据池]
G --> H[自动化注入]

实战方案:

  • 数据编织技术:通过元数据自动构建实体关系图谱

  • 容器化供给:基于K8s的按版本数据快照分发

  • 智能生成策略

    def generate_test_data(pattern):
    if pattern == "边界值":
    return create_edge_cases()
    elif pattern == "业务流":
    return simulate_transaction_chain()
    # 支持扩展生成规则

三、隐私脱敏:动态防护体系

防护层级

核心技术

实施要点

静态脱敏

格式保留加密(FPE)

保留数据类型与业务规则

动态脱敏

代理网关拦截

实时替换生产查询结果

合成数据

GAN生成对抗网络

构建无真实信息的拟真数据

合规性验证框架:

  1. 敏感字段自动识别(正则+NLP双引擎)

  2. 脱敏效力验证(信息熵分析+相似度检测)

  3. 审计追踪(完整的数据血缘图谱)

四、DevOps集成路线图

timeline
title 测试数据管道进化阶段
2023 Q4 : 基础数据沙箱建设
2024 Q2 : 自动化脱敏流水线
2025 Q1 : AI驱动的按需生成
2025 Q4 : 区块链审计溯源

实施收益矩阵

  • 数据准备时效提升70%

  • 隐私合规成本降低45%

  • 缺陷捕捉率增加32%

结语

当测试数据完成从"被动获取"到"智能供给"的范式转移,测试团队将真正成为质量防控的战略枢纽。下一阶段的战场,在于构建跨系统的数据治理生态链。

精选文章

从UI到契约:API契约测试如何成为微服务质量的“定海神针”?

混沌工程赋能稳定性测试:你敢对生产环境“搞破坏”吗?

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/10 7:11:34

【前端学习AI】大模型调用实战

本地部署:基于Ollama调用开源大模型 Ollama 是轻量级本地大模型运行框架,无需依赖云端服务,可快速部署通义千问、Llama 等开源大模型,特别适合无网络环境或隐私敏感场景。 步骤1:安装Ollama 从官方网站下载并安装&a…

作者头像 李华
网站建设 2026/4/15 13:36:39

LeetCode 3075.幸福值最大化的选择方案:排序

【LetMeFly】3075.幸福值最大化的选择方案:排序 力扣题目链接:https://leetcode.cn/problems/maximize-happiness-of-selected-children/ 给你一个长度为 n 的数组 happiness ,以及一个 正整数 k 。 n 个孩子站成一队,其中第 i…

作者头像 李华
网站建设 2026/4/13 9:51:23

Open-AutoGLM 2.0实战指南:从零到部署的完整路径,节省200+开发工时

第一章:Open-AutoGLM 2.0实战指南:从零到部署的完整路径,节省200开发工时 环境准备与依赖安装 在开始使用 Open-AutoGLM 2.0 前,确保系统已安装 Python 3.9 及 pip 包管理工具。推荐使用虚拟环境以隔离项目依赖。 创建虚拟环境&…

作者头像 李华
网站建设 2026/4/15 19:27:54

(独家解读)智谱Open-AutoGLM论文中的7个创新点,99%的人还没注意到

第一章:智谱Open-AutoGLM论文的核心贡献概述智谱AI发布的Open-AutoGLM论文提出了一种面向中文场景自动化的大型语言模型(LLM)应用框架,旨在降低大模型在实际任务中的使用门槛。该框架通过引入任务感知的提示工程与自动化微调机制&…

作者头像 李华
网站建设 2026/4/15 18:38:18

16、Windows Azure 存储客户端开发与认证详解

Windows Azure 存储客户端开发与认证详解 在使用 Windows Azure 存储服务时,理解如何通过 REST API 进行操作以及如何构建一个简单的存储客户端是非常重要的。下面将详细介绍相关的关键概念和操作步骤。 1. 基本概念 URL :URL 用于标识你想要获取的资源。在 Windows Azur…

作者头像 李华
网站建设 2026/4/15 18:37:24

18、Windows Azure Blob 存储服务全解析

Windows Azure Blob 存储服务全解析 在云计算时代,存储服务是至关重要的基础设施之一。Windows Azure Blob 存储服务提供了强大且灵活的存储解决方案,下面将详细介绍其定价、数据模型、使用注意事项、API 及客户端库的使用,以及容器的相关操作。 1. 定价策略 Windows Azu…

作者头像 李华